(RADIATOR) Problem with AuthBy SQL on Windows (not Linux) after upgrade from 3.16 to 3.17.1

Mike McCauley mikem at open.com.au
Mon Aug 27 17:42:09 CDT 2007


Hello Jason,

thanks for reporting this.
It appears to be caused by a recent patch that is incompatible with your 
version of Perl.
We have now adjusted this patch so that it will be compatible.
The new patch is available in the latest patch set.

We apologise for any inconvenience.

Cheers.

On Monday 27 August 2007 21:19, L. Jason Godsey wrote:
> >From config:
>
> 77: <AuthBy SQL>
> 78: 	Identifier PLAT5
> 79:	DBSource dbi:ODBC:PLATYPUS5
>
> Mon Aug 27 04:06:11 2007: ERR: Could not load AuthBy module
> Radius::AuthSQL: Constant name 'HASH(0x1f6fa84)' has invalid characters
> at C:/Perl/site/lib/Radius/SqlDb.pm line 49
> BEGIN failed--compilation aborted at C:/Perl/site/lib/Radius/SqlDb.pm
> line 50, <FILE> line 77.
> Compilation failed in require at C:/Perl/site/lib/Radius/AuthSQL.pm
> line 12, <FILE> line 77.
> BEGIN failed--compilation aborted at C:/Perl/site/lib/Radius/AuthSQL.pm
> line 12, <FILE> line 77.
> Compilation failed in require at (eval 43) line 3, <FILE> line 77.
>
> Mon Aug 27 04:06:11 2007: ERR: Unknown object 'AuthBy' in C:\Program
> Files\Radiator\radius.cfg line 77
> Mon Aug 27 04:06:28 2007: ERR: Could not load AuthBy module
> Radius::AuthSQL: Constant name 'HASH(0x1f6fa84)' has invalid characters
> at C:/Perl/site/lib/Radius/SqlDb.pm line 49
> BEGIN failed--compilation aborted at C:/Perl/site/lib/Radius/SqlDb.pm
> line 50, <FILE> line 77.
> Compilation failed in require at C:/Perl/site/lib/Radius/AuthSQL.pm
> line 12, <FILE> line 77.
> BEGIN failed--compilation aborted at C:/Perl/site/lib/Radius/AuthSQL.pm
> line 12, <FILE> line 77.
> Compilation failed in require at (eval 43) line 3, <FILE> line 77.
>
> Mon Aug 27 04:06:28 2007: ERR: Unknown object 'AuthBy' in C:\Program
> Files\Radiator\radius.cfg line 77
>
>
>
>
> --
> Archive at http://www.open.com.au/archives/radiator/
> Announcements on radiator-announce at open.com.au
> To unsubscribe, email 'majordomo at open.com.au' with
> 'unsubscribe radiator' in the body of the message.

-- 
Mike McCauley                               mikem at open.com.au
Open System Consultants Pty. Ltd            Unix, Perl, Motif, C++, WWW
9 Bulbul Place Currumbin Waters QLD 4223 Australia   http://www.open.com.au
Phone +61 7 5598-7474                       Fax   +61 7 5598-7070

Radiator: the most portable, flexible and configurable RADIUS server 
anywhere. SQL, proxy, DBM, files, LDAP, NIS+, password, NT, Emerald, 
Platypus, Freeside, TACACS+, PAM, external, Active Directory, EAP, TLS, 
TTLS, PEAP etc on Unix, Windows, MacOS, NetWare etc.

--
Archive at http://www.open.com.au/archives/radiator/
Announcements on radiator-announce at open.com.au
To unsubscribe, email 'majordomo at open.com.au' with
'unsubscribe radiator' in the body of the message.


More information about the radiator mailing list